Can you use the magicjack with a cordless phone or do you always have to talk on the computer throught the magicjack

You can use the magicjack with most phones, just like with any other kind of service.

The broadband and computer have to be on, but you can close off one of the internal lines in your house and then call from any phone jack that you wish.

Calls are free in the U.S. and Canada. They are planning to have international rates. However, if the international line has a magicjack, then you can call them and they can call you for free.

Right now, magicJack only allows calls to the US and Canada.
They do not have "international" calling capability.

However, there's a post from someone who bought one, set it up, and then mailed it overseas to relatives. They can now use it to call back to the US.
You can take your magicJack anywhere in the world, and call back to the US and Canada "free". But you won't be able to call anyone in the country you're visiting.

If you have a MJ, and you send a friend an MJ in Italy (as an example), you can call each other for free. That's because even though your friend is physically in Italy, his phone number is in the US - so to MJ you're making a US to US phone call.
